CASSIDA GREASE SGG 000
Synthetic semi-fluid gearbox grease for food and beverage processing equipment
Description
CASSIDA GREASE SGG 000 is food grade quality, semi-fluid grease developed to provide industrial grade lubrication for enclosed stationary gearboxes. It is designed to provide maximum performance and protection for equipment used in food and beverage processing plants.
This product is formulated with full synthetic PAO (polyalphaolefin) base fluid with aluminum complex thicker and selected additives to meet the most stringent requirements of the food and beverage industry.
CASSIDA GREASE SGG 000 is produced under highest quality standards in FUCHS facilities where HACCP audit and Good Manufacturing Practice have been implemented.
Certified by NSF to ISO 21469 and H1 qualifications for use where incidental food contact is possible.

Performance Features
- Operating Temperatures: -40°C to 149°C (-40°F to 300°F)
- Excellent anti-wear and extreme pressure properties
- Wide temperature range
- Good water resistance
- Corrosion prevention properties
- Extended service life
- Neutral odor
Applications
- Enclosed stationery gearboxes
- Fill-for-Life gearboxes
- Centralized lubrication systems calling for NLGI grade 000 grease

Handling and storage
All food grade lubricants should be stored separately from other lubricants, chemical substances and foodstuffs and out of direct sunlight or other heat sources. Store between 32 °F and 100 °F. Provided that the product has been stored under these conditions we recommend that the product be used within 5 years from the date of manufacture or within 2 years after the original container has been opened, whichever is sooner.
